El Web Scraping, una técnica que ha revolucionado la forma en que recopilamos información en la era digital, está en el centro de muchas discusiones. ¿Qué es el Web Scraping? ¿Es legal? ¿Cómo hacerlo de manera ética y efectiva? Acompáñanos mientras exploramos estos temas.
¿Qué es el Web Scraping?
El Web Scraping, o extracción de datos web, es el proceso de recopilar información de páginas web de forma automatizada. En esencia, es como enviar un "robot" a explorar la web y extraer datos de interés, como textos, imágenes, precios de productos o cualquier otro tipo de información. Es una técnica poderosa que se utiliza en una variedad de campos, desde la recopilación de datos para análisis de mercado hasta la creación de aplicaciones y servicios.
Legalidad del Web Scraping
La legalidad del Web Scraping puede variar según la jurisdicción y la manera en que se utiliza. Aquí hay algunas pautas generales:
1. Términos de Servicio: Si un sitio web prohíbe el Web Scraping en sus términos de servicio, es importante respetar esas reglas. Ignorar estas restricciones puede llevar a problemas legales.
2. Derechos de autor y propiedad intelectual: No debes copiar ni utilizar datos protegidos por derechos de autor sin permiso. Asegúrate de que los datos que extraigas no infrinjan los derechos de propiedad intelectual.
3. Cumplimiento con las leyes de privacidad: Respetar las leyes de privacidad y protección de datos es esencial. Evita recopilar información personal sin consentimiento.
4. Utilización ética: Utiliza el Web Scraping de manera ética y no para actividades ilegales o perjudiciales.
Recomendaciones antes de hacer Web Scraping
Antes de comenzar un proyecto de Web Scraping, considera las siguientes recomendaciones:
1. Verifica la legalidad: Investiga las leyes locales y los términos de servicio del sitio web que deseas raspar. Asegúrate de cumplir con todas las restricciones legales y éticas.
2. Respeto por los servidores: Evita sobrecargar los servidores del sitio web con solicitudes excesivas. Utiliza tasas de rastreo adecuadas para no afectar el rendimiento del sitio.
3. Utiliza una biblioteca de Web Scraping: En lugar de crear tu propio código desde cero, utiliza bibliotecas de Web Scraping disponibles, como Beautiful Soup o Scrapy. Estas herramientas te facilitarán el proceso.
4. Prueba en entornos de desarrollo: Antes de realizar un Web Scraping a gran escala, realiza pruebas en entornos de desarrollo para evitar errores y asegurarte de que tu código funciona correctamente.
5. Respeto por los datos: Utiliza los datos de manera ética y con respeto por la privacidad. No vendas ni compartas información sensible sin autorización.
Sitios para Web Scraping
Octoparse.es
Tiene versión básica gratis y de pago, idioma ingles.
GRATIS
10 tareas
Ejecutar tareas solo en dispositivos locales
Hasta 10 mil filas de datos por exportaciónquestion
Páginas ilimitadas cada ejecución
Dispositivos ilimitados
Soporte limitado
Octolooks.com
El complemento de rastreo de contenido y raspador de WordPress más avanzado para extraer contenido de cualquier sitio web automáticamente con un selector visual, idioma inglés.
Versión solo de pago, pago único según su sitio web desde $35 USD
Funciona con WooCommerce.
Desde las tiendas en línea, puede utilizar el tipo de publicación personalizada y la compatibilidad con campos personalizados en su tienda WooCommerce para recopilar contenido en forma de productos.
Obtenga ingresos vendiendo productos en su propia tienda o redirigiéndolos al sitio de destino a través de un programa de afiliados